Le Creuset 13-Quart Round French Oven

Le Creuset 13-Quart Round French Oven : Perfect for crowd-pleasing roasts, casseroles, and stews, this round French oven is known as "the everyday pot" for its multifaceted uses: baking, broiling, braising, sauteing or marinating. It's also "the everywhere pot" because it serves equally well on the stovetop, in the oven, on the table, or in the refrigerator or freezer. The mainstay of French chefs for nearly a century, Le Creuset cookware features bold and bright colors in a variety of shapes and sizes to suit any culinary need and home décor. Each enameled cast iron cookware piece is skillfully finished by hand. Dishwasher-safe, but hand-washing is recommended. Made in France. 13 1/4 Quart capacity. 20 lbs. 11 1/2" Dia. x 7"H. Product Features Molded of cast iron with an expertly enameled glossy porcelain coating All-in-one French oven beautifully goes from freezer or fridge straight to cooking device to table, then back to freezer or fridge for storage of leftovers Versatile for stovetop, oven and broiler Highest quality porcelain enamel coating is impermeable to odors and stains Foods will not react with the enameled finish Easy-clean enamel surfaces are scratch-resistant Superior conduction of heat promotes faster cooking times Even distribution and retention of heat ensures cookware stays hot longer Heavy, tight-fitting lid seals in moisture and flavors - food self-bastes Sure-grip phenolic knob is ovenproof to 400 F; do not place knob under broiler Dish without lid is safe for oven or broiler up to 400 F Suited for stovetops including electric, gas, ceramic, induction and halogen top This item is shipped directly from the manufacturer so it can only be delivered within the 48 contiguous states. Yes it's a little pricey and a little heavy but it's eye-catchingly beautiful and the best cast iron dutch oven you will find on the market today. Le Creuset makes the best quality cast iron cookware available today. This French oven is extremely versatile and perfect for anything which requires long slow cooking either on the stovetop or in the oven. An iron pot takes longer to heat up than say stainless steel or aluminum but it holds heat longer than either. It cooks everything so perfectly pot roast, soup, stew, pasta sauces, chili, gumbo, braising, slow-cooking, etc and it is incredibly easy to clean without scubbing by soaking overnight in hot, soapy water. And best of all it will outlast almost all of your other cookware.
